Inside JioHotstar: A 5-Step Viewing Guide
JioHotstar is an India-focused streaming service for TV shows, movies, specials, live cricket and football, combining the former JioCinema and Disney+ Hotstar libraries. It serves viewers through the JioHotstar website, Android and iOS apps, smart TVs, connected devices and selected Jio services. Its catalogue includes Indian originals, regional entertainment, Hollywood titles, Disney content and major sports coverage, although availability can change by licence, plan and location. In 2026, viewers should check device limits, language options, advertising rules and live-event rights before subscribing. How does JioHotstar handle live cricket and football?
JioHotstar handles live cricket and football through event pages, scheduled streams, live score interfaces and rights-based availability. The stream usually requires a compatible plan or account condition, and the exact access rule can differ between free, ad-supported and premium content.
Live sport is where timing risk rises sharply. On-demand television can wait 20 minutes; a cricket over or football goal cannot. JioHotstar may show a countdown, “live now” label, language selection and quality controls, but the visible interface does not prove that every viewer has identical access. Account region, mobile number verification, device compatibility and traffic load can all affect the result.
Use this five-step match routine:
- Open the official JioHotstar app or website. Avoid unofficial mirror pages. They create malware, privacy and stream-stability risks.
- Search the named competition. Enter terms such as “ICC,” “FIFA,” “football live” or the exact team names.
- Open the official event card. Confirm start time, language, subscription label and available commentary.
- Test playback 10 minutes early. Check audio, resolution, subtitles and casting before the first whistle or delivery.
- Keep a backup data path. A second Wi-Fi connection or mobile hotspot can prevent a single-router failure.
A useful operational insight is the 10-minute test window. Many viewers troubleshoot only after a stream fails at kickoff. That is late. Network congestion, account refreshes and app updates are easier to handle before the event begins. For high-demand matches, also close unused devices connected to the same account and router. JioHotstar’s displayed quality may adapt automatically; “Full HD” is not guaranteed when bandwidth fluctuates.
The International Telecommunication Union identifies application requirements as dependent on service type, including interactive video and real-time communication. Live sports is especially sensitive to delay and buffering. Your practical target is stable playback, not merely the highest number shown in the quality menu.

What about regional languages, specials and family viewing?
JioHotstar supports a broad mix of regional languages, entertainment specials and family-oriented programming, but the exact audio, subtitle and age-rating options must be checked title by title. A programme’s presence in the catalogue does not guarantee every language track or a commercial-free experience.
Language discovery is one of the platform’s practical strengths. Viewers can often browse by language, genre, channel or franchise, then select audio and subtitle settings during playback. However, metadata is not always perfectly uniform across devices. The Android app, smart-TV app and browser version may display different menu positions, especially after an update. This creates a common failure: the user assumes a language track is missing when it is simply located under the audio icon.
For a safer family setup, inspect these details:
- Age rating: confirm the programme classification before children watch independently.
- Profile controls: use available restrictions where supported by the account and device.
- Audio language: test the chosen track for both films and live broadcasts.
- Subtitles: check size, contrast and synchronisation on the television.
- Autoplay: disable it if younger viewers use the profile without supervision.
- Downloads: verify whether offline access is allowed for that title and plan.
The service may also include specials tied to Indian television, festivals, celebrity events, documentaries and sports ceremonies. These programmes can have shorter availability windows than major series. A title marked “coming soon” may disappear from a search page after rights expire, while an archived special may remain visible but inaccessible. That is why saving a programme is not the same as downloading it.

Where does JioHotstar fail?
JioHotstar’s main weaknesses are changing content rights, advertising or plan restrictions, regional availability, device limits and occasional live-stream instability. These are not unusual streaming problems, but they become more expensive when a viewer discovers them during a major cricket or football event.
The first limitation is catalogue uncertainty. JioHotstar can promote a franchise while only selected seasons, episodes or films are available. The second is plan ambiguity. A lower-priced mobile option may prioritise smartphone viewing, while broader device access, premium titles or reduced advertising can require another tier. Prices, benefits and promotional bundles can change, especially when linked to Jio telecommunications offers. Never treat a screenshot from 2024 or 2025 as a 2026 price sheet.
The third problem is technical fragmentation. A title can play on an Android phone but fail on an older smart television because of operating-system support, DRM compatibility or outdated firmware. Casting may also depend on Chromecast, AirPlay, television brand and network configuration. “The app is installed” does not mean “the device is supported.”
Use this troubleshooting sequence:
- Update JioHotstar and the device operating system.
- Sign out, restart the device and sign in again.
- Test another network, preferably mobile data for diagnosis.
- Reduce video quality if buffering continues.
- Check whether the account is active on too many devices.
- Search the official help centre before reinstalling.
- Record the error code, device model and event name for support.
A contrarian but useful conclusion follows: paying for the most expensive plan does not automatically solve buffering. In a controlled comparison, a stable 50 Mbps connection on a current television is more valuable than a premium tier running through an overloaded 4G hotspot. The bottleneck is often the network path, not the subscription. That is the kind of detail promotional pages tend to omit.
The Internet Engineering Task Force describes real-time transport requirements around packet delivery and timing. You do not need to configure network protocols manually, but the principle is clear: latency, packet loss and congestion can damage live video even when headline bandwidth looks adequate.

Q: What is the difference between JioHotstar and JioCinema?
A: JioHotstar is the combined streaming brand that followed the integration of JioCinema and Disney+ Hotstar in India. JioCinema was strongly associated with Jio’s local entertainment and sports offering, while Disney+ Hotstar contributed its established international, Indian television and sports catalogue. The current experience, plans and library should be checked through JioHotstar directly because legacy pages may show outdated names, prices or access rules.
Q: Why does JioHotstar keep buffering during live matches?
A: Buffering usually results from congestion, weak Wi-Fi, packet loss, device limitations or an outdated application rather than the subscription price alone. Restart the router, test mobile data, reduce video quality and close other streams before reinstalling the app. If the issue occurs only during one high-demand event, record the time, error code and device model. A stable connection and supported hardware can matter more than a premium plan.
